Fall is one of our favorite seasons in Southern California. As the temperatures start to cool in late September and the crisp autumn air replaces the summer heat, we find ourselves wandering to some of our favorite places where fall is at its finest. From lakeside destinations to mountain retreats, this picture-perfect list will take you to the most beautiful fall destinations in Southern California! - Green Valley Lake
Green Valley Lake/Facebook Known as the “best-kept secret in the San Bernardino Mountains,” a day trip or weekend getaway to Green Valley Lake will quickly become your new favorite fall destination. Spend some time out on the water and soak up the colorful scenery all around you that captures the very best of the fall season. Green Valley Lake, CA 92341, USA
- Oak Glen
Don Graham/Flickr The town of Oak Glen is home to some of SoCal’s most charming farms. With an abundance of orchards, u-pick farms, and serene country backroads, this peaceful hideaway is always at the top of our list for a beautiful fall destination. Oak Glen, CA 92399, USA
- Lake Arrowhead
Lake Arrowhead Village/Facebook Fall in Southern California isn’t official until you’ve made a day trip to this mountain town in SoCal. With the changing colors of the leaves and the festive vibe inside the village, you’ll be drawn to Lake Arrowhead, where the autumn season comes to life. Lake Arrowhead, CA, USA
- Big Bear Lake
Big Bear Lake Village/Facebook Seeking out one of the best spots in SoCal to view the fall colors? Head to Big Bear Lake and take a stroll along the main street for a dazzling dose of autumn that will make your fall season complete. Big Bear Lake, CA, USA
- Wrightwood
Rennett Stowe/Wikimedia Wrightwood comes to life every autumn season with the most vibrant fall colors imaginable. From its tree-lined streets to its local shops and eateries, this cozy town is a great pick for a fall day trip or overnighter. Wrightwood, CA, USA
- Jackson Lake
Rennett Stowe/Wikimedia Not far from the heart of Wrightwood you’ll find Jackson Lake. This picturesque setting is tucked along Big Pines Highway in the Angeles National Forest. With its colorful foliage and serene setting, this is one beautiful place to visit during the fall season. Jackson Lake, California 93563, USA
- Julian
geoff dude/Flickr Known for its apple orchards and apple pies and colorful fall leaves, this cozy small town in Southern California should be at the top of everyone’s list who wants to experience the beauty of the fall season in Southern California. Julian, CA 92036, USA

Fall in Southern California August 15, 2022 Tori Jane Where are some of the best places to visit in the fall in Southern California? Just because Southern California is known as a haven for beachgoers doesn’t mean it’s a slouch during autumn. Sure, summer is the most popular time of year for people to visit, but maybe they should consider a fall adventure, too! Some of the best places to visit in the fall here include some truly amazing state parks in Southern California, and you really can’t miss an opportunity to go camping in Southern California while the colors are at their most vivid, either. Head out on one of our fall color road trips in SoCal, or maybe check out some of our city parks! Anywhere you find trees, you’ll find brilliant color. Where is the best place to visit in the fall in Southern California? When it comes to specifics, there are some places that tend to stick out more than others in terms of fall color in Southern California – so where are the best places to visit in the fall in Southern California? We love, believe it or not, the Los Angeles area, where there are plenty of options, like Lacy Park and the Whittier Narrows Recreation Area. The Los Angeles Arboretum is, of course, another excellent option. We love checking out the color at Big Bear Lake, in Big Bear, and we’re pretty sure Grass Valley Lake at Lake Arrowhead is another 100% perfect destination for leaf-peepers. But the list goes on: What are the most amazing fall destinations in Southern California? Alright, let’s get even more specific. Some of the most amazing fall destinations in Southern California include parks, lakes, and vistas like Lake Hemet, Hot Springs Mountain (near San Diego), Palomar Mountain State Park (also near San Diego), and the entire town of Julian. A lot of the small towns in Southern California get some excellent color, at least for a little while, and they make for the perfect autumn getaways. You also cannot miss an opportunity to head out to Malibu Creek State Park, which is amazing all year but definitely gets even more magical during autumn.
